    摘要: A communication system performing a coordinated multipoint transmission is provided. A mobile station may measure expected channel quality information when an interference of a serving base station does not exist. The serving base station may determine whether a neighbor base station and the serving base station are eligible to perform the coordinated multipoint transmission. The serving base station may determine whether the neighbor base station and the serving base station are eligible to perform the coordinated multipoint transmission using a criterion associated with an evaluation of an increase in a transmission rate of the mobile station.

    摘要: A terminal receives a unique sequence from each of at least two base stations, and transmits a mixture of quantized unique sequences to a serving base station. The serving base station extracts components respectively corresponding to base stations from the mixture of the quantized unique sequences, and estimates a location of a terminal based on the extracted components. The serving base station may calculate a received signal strength or a delay for each of the unique sequences received by the terminal, based on the extracted components, and estimate the location of the terminal based on the received signal strength or the delay. In addition, the terminal may estimate its own location by performing an algorithm used by the serving base station.
